Результаты поиска по запросу "nhibernate-mapping"

3 ответа

Таблица соединений «многие ко многим» NHibernate Map

Моя структура базы данных выглядит примерно так: Person Id Name FieldA FieldB Phone Id Number PersonPhone PhoneId PersonId IsDefaultМое сопоставление NHibernate для объектов Person и Phone прямое, с PersonPhone у меня возникли сложности. Я хочу ...

2 ответа

FluentNHibernate и Enums

У меня есть enum под названием Permissions. Пользователю могут быть назначены разрешения, или разрешения могут быть назначены роли, и пользователю может быть назначена роль. User и Role имеют свойство, подобное этому: public virtual ...

2 ответа

NHibernate HiLo - новый столбец для объекта и HiLo ловит

В настоящее время я использую генератор идентификаторов hilo для своих классов, но только что использовал минимальные настройки, например <class name="ClassA"> <id name="Id" column="id" unsaved-value="0"> <generator class="hilo" /> </id> ...Но ...

ТОП публикаций

2 ответа

Свободное владение Nhibernate левый

Я хочу отобразить класс, который приведет к левому внешнему соединению, а не к внутреннему соединению. Мой составной пользовательский объект состоит из одной таблицы («aspnet_users») и некоторых необязательных свойств во второй таблице ...

2 ответа

NHibernate - HQL «выборка соединения» с ошибкой выбрасывания SetMaxResults

Я пытаюсь выполнить самый простой запрос: string queryStr = "select b " + "from Blog b " + "left outer join fetch b.BlogComments bc"; IList<Blog> blogs = Session.CreateQuery(queryStr) .SetMaxResults(10) .List<Blog>();Но он выдает следующую ...

2 ответа

Коллекция фильтров NHibernate

Используя NHibernate, я хочу отфильтровать коллекцию в классе, чтобы она содержала ТОЛЬКО подмножество возможных объектов. Ниже я приведу пример таблицы данных, чтобы помочь объяснить. Я не могу найти способ сделать это с ...

1 ответ

Можно ли вызвать хранимую процедуру, используя NHibernate, который возвращает пользовательский объект вместо объекта домена?

У меня есть несколько хранимых процедур, которые не возвращают доменные объекты (т. Е. Объекты, которые имеют соответствующее сопоставление таблиц sql в файлах hbm); но вместо этого вернуть пользовательские объекты. Я хочу вызывать эти хранимые ...

2 ответа

Как правильно реализовать IUserType?

Мне нужно создатьпользовательский тип [https://www.hibernate.org/hib_docs/nhibernate/1.2/reference/en/html/mapping.html#mapping-types-custom] заNHibernate [https://www.hibernate.org]написав новый класс Mapper, который реализуетIUserType, Хотя ...

5 ответов

NHibernate: как включить отложенную загрузку при однозначном отображении

Отношения один-к-одному в nhibernate могут быть загружены как «false» или «proxy». Мне было интересно, если кто-нибудь знает способ сделать ленивое сопоставление один к одному. Я разработал хак для достижения того же результата, используя ...